# Qase3D introduces MDR system form hospital 3D labs

Point-of-Care (PoC) manufacturing facilities and other producers of custom-made medical devices must comply with the European Medical Device Regulation (MDR). One of the core requirements under the MDR is the implementation of a Quality Management System (QMS). Although [ISO 13485 is the globally recognized standard](https://www.voxelmatters.com/oechslerhealth-qualifies-iso-13485-additive-manufacturing-line-for-medical-devices/) for medical device QMS, it is often too extensive for small manufacturers such as hospital-based 3D labs - while still not covering every MDR requirement. As a result, even fully ISO 13485-certified organizations must perform additional MDR-specific activities. Recognizing this gap, [Qase3D, a 3D printed medical device company](https://www.voxelmatters.directory/company/qase3d/), and Waveland European Lawyers have partnered to introduce a streamlined MDR Management System tailored specifically to hospital 3D labs producing custom-made anatomical models, surgical guides, and patient-specific implants.

The solution builds upon Waveland’s proven online platform - widely used by podiatrists in the Netherlands, who, like PoC labs, are classified as small medical device manufacturers. The platform translates complex MDR requirements into clear, actionable policies written in plain language. Users work through 18 structured chapters, completing checkboxes, forms, and tables related to their organization and products. Once the platform reaches 100%, the user knows they meet the MDR requirements for custom-made devices.

Unlike [traditional QMS implementations](https://www.voxelmatters.com/kam-invests-in-security-digital-erp-mes-qms/), the Waveland platform focuses solely on what the MDR legally requires - nothing more and nothing less. The platform can function as a stand-alone MDR Management System for small manufacturers or can be integrated into an ISO 13485-based QMS for larger facilities. Waveland ensures continuous compliance by maintaining the content in line with evolving legislation.

As part of the collaboration, Qase3D provides onboarding, initial implementation, and an annual audit. With extensive experience in hospital 3D printing operations, Qase3D ensures PoC labs understand both the regulatory context and the practical reality of producing patient-specific devices.

"While supporting several PoC labs in building their ISO 13485 QMS, I received more questions about the MDR than about the standard itself. Because the goal isn’t to build a QMS, the goal is to achieve MDR compliance. I discovered that to truly understand the MDR, we need European legal expertise. That search led me to Waveland. Their MDR portal was an eye-opener; I never expected MDR compliance could be achieved so practically," said Erik Boelen, Founder of Qase3D.

"It’s in my DNA to make complex things simple. With Waveland, we translated the MDR into clear, understandable language and practical actions. Our MDR Management System is recommended by the National Podiatry Association in the Netherlands. Together with Qase3D, we adapted the system so European hospitals can now benefit from the same simplicity when producing custom-made devices at the Point-of-Care," said Benedikt Marijnen, Founder of Waveland European Lawyers.
